2. Invest in the Right Equipment

Camera

  • DSLR or Mirrorless: These offer the best image quality and flexibility. Brands like Canon, Nikon, and Sony are popular choices.

  • Smartphone: High-end models from Apple and Samsung can also produce stunning results with the right techniques.

Lenses

  • 50mm f/1.8: Great for portraits and low-light situations.

  • 85mm f/1.4: Ideal for detailed, intimate shots.

  • Wide-angle (e.g., 24mm f/1.4): Perfect for environmental and creative compositions.

Lighting

  • Softboxes: Provide soft, diffused light that's flattering for most subjects.

  • Umbrellas: Great for larger, softer light sources.

  • Ring Lights: Useful for eliminating shadows and creating a professional look.

Accessories

  • Tripod: Essential for stability and consistency.

  • Remote Shutter Release: Helps avoid camera shake.

  • Reflectors: Useful for bouncing light and filling shadows.

3. Mastering Lighting Techniques

Natural Light

  • Use large windows or doors to create soft, natural light.

  • Shoot during the "golden hours" (just after sunrise or before sunset) for warm, flattering light.

Studio Lighting

  • Three-point Lighting: Key light, fill light, and back light to create dimension and depth.

  • High Key: Bright, even lighting with minimal shadows.

  • Low Key: Dramatic, moody lighting with strong contrasts.

Composition

  • Rule of Thirds: Place your subject off-center for a more dynamic composition.

  • Framing: Use natural or man-made elements to frame your subject and draw attention to them.

  • Depth of Field: Use a shallow depth of field (large aperture) to blur the background and make your subject pop.

6. Editing and Post-Processing
Software
  • Adobe Lightroom: Great for basic edits and batch processing.

  • Adobe Photoshop: Offers advanced editing capabilities for more complex manipulations.

Techniques

  • Color Correction: Ensure your whites are white and your blacks are black.

  • Sharpening: Enhance details without making the image look unnatural.

  • Retouching: Remove blemishes, smooth skin, and enhance features subtly.

Presets

  • Create or purchase presets to maintain a consistent aesthetic across your photos.
